Buying Guide

Power and runtime: Battery-powered models like the ST1511T and ISPRINTIME options provide mobility but require attention to battery life and charging times. If you have a large yard, consider a model with a longer runtime or a second battery.

2-in-1 versatility: Trimmers that convert to edgers with a wheel guide offer precise borders and cleaner lines. Ensure the conversion is quick and tool-free if possible to minimize downtime between tasks.

Line feeding system: Auto-feed spools or Powerload-style mechanisms reduce the need for manual bumping. This improves workflow, especially during heavy trimming sessions.

Weight and ergonomics: Lighter machines reduce user fatigue, especially for extended sessions. Adjustable shafts and handles help tailor the tool to different users and mowing heights.

Accessories and compatibility: Check included batteries, chargers, and spools. For battery models, confirm compatibility with existing brands if you already own a system, as that can save money and storage space.

Cutting width and path: A wider cutting path covers more ground per pass but may require more power. For compact yards with tight edges, a smaller path can be easier to maneuver.

Durability and warranty: Look for sturdy construction and a warranty that covers motor components and spools. This provides peace of mind across seasonal use and varying weather conditions.
